Your Energy Drops Are Actually Biological Messages

When energy drops hit, most people blame themselves. We think we’re lazy, undisciplined, or just having an “off day.” But science tells a different story.

Your energy levels follow predictable patterns throughout the day, controlled by complex interactions between your circadian rhythm, blood sugar, hormone fluctuations, and neurotransmitter activity. When these systems fall out of sync, your energy crashes hard.

“Energy drops are rarely random,” explains Dr. Michael Chen, a sleep medicine specialist. “They’re usually your body’s way of signaling that something in your biological rhythm is misaligned.”

Think of it like your phone battery. When it suddenly drops from 50% to 15%, you don’t assume the phone is broken—you look for what’s draining it. Your body works the same way.

The Hidden Patterns Behind Your Daily Energy Crashes

Most energy drops cluster around specific times, and each pattern reveals different underlying causes. Here’s what your crash timing might be telling you:

Time of Energy Drop Likely Causes What It Really Means
10-11 AM Blood sugar crash, cortisol dip Breakfast wasn’t balanced or sufficient
1-3 PM Post-meal glucose spike, circadian low Normal biology amplified by poor sleep
4-5 PM Decision fatigue, adenosine buildup Mental resources depleted from constant choices
7-8 PM Natural melatonin rise Body preparing for sleep cycle

The most common culprits behind energy drops include:

  • Blood sugar rollercoaster: High-carb meals cause spikes followed by crashes
  • Dehydration: Even mild dehydration reduces cognitive performance by 12%
  • Poor sleep quality: Disrupted sleep throws off your entire energy rhythm
  • Stress hormones: Chronic stress depletes your energy reserves faster
  • Nutrient deficiencies: Low iron, B12, or vitamin D directly impact energy production

“The afternoon slump isn’t a character flaw,” notes nutritionist Dr. Lisa Martinez. “It’s often a combination of natural circadian dips and blood sugar instability from lunch choices.”

What Your Body Is Really Trying to Tell You

Different types of energy drops send different messages. Learning to decode them can help you address the root cause instead of just pushing through with more caffeine.

When you feel suddenly foggy and unfocused, your brain might be running low on glucose or fighting inflammation from something you ate. That heavy, sleepy feeling often signals blood sugar swings or dehydration.

Physical exhaustion that hits without mental fatigue usually points to sleep debt, overtraining, or nutrient depletion. Meanwhile, that scattered, anxious energy crash often comes from stress hormones wreaking havoc on your system.

“Energy management is really about listening to your body’s signals and responding appropriately,” explains fatigue researcher Dr. James Wong. “Most people try to override the signals instead of addressing what’s causing them.”

Pay attention to what you were doing in the hour before your energy drops. Did you skip breakfast? Eat a sugary snack? Spend thirty minutes scrolling social media? Have a stressful phone call? These seemingly small events can trigger energy crashes hours later.

Your environment matters too. Poor lighting, stuffy air, or even sitting in the same position for hours can drain your energy reserves. Open-plan offices, constant notifications, and back-to-back meetings create a perfect storm for energy depletion.

Breaking the Energy Drop Cycle

Once you understand what’s really happening, you can start making targeted changes. Small adjustments often create surprisingly big improvements in your energy stability.

Start by tracking your energy levels for a week. Note when crashes happen, what you ate beforehand, how you slept, and what you were doing. Patterns will emerge quickly.

For blood sugar stability, focus on balanced meals with protein, healthy fats, and complex carbs. A Greek yogurt with berries and nuts beats a muffin every time for sustained energy.

If dehydration is your culprit, try drinking a full glass of water when you first notice energy flagging. You’ll often feel better within 15 minutes.

For stress-related crashes, even five minutes of deep breathing or a quick walk can reset your nervous system. Your energy drops aren’t personal failings—they’re biological feedback that becomes incredibly useful once you know how to read it.

FAQs

Why do I always crash at 3 PM even when I eat a healthy lunch?
This timing aligns with your natural circadian low point, which happens regardless of what you eat. Poor sleep quality makes this dip much more pronounced.

Can caffeine make energy drops worse?
Yes, especially if you’re using it to override your body’s signals. Too much caffeine can disrupt sleep and create bigger crashes when it wears off.

How long should it take to see improvement in energy levels?
Small changes like better hydration show results within days, while sleep and nutrition improvements typically take 1-2 weeks to stabilize your energy patterns.

Are energy drops different for men and women?
Women often experience more variation due to hormonal fluctuations throughout their cycle, with energy drops more pronounced during certain phases.

Should I be concerned if my energy crashes are getting worse?
If energy drops are increasing in frequency or severity despite lifestyle improvements, consider checking for underlying conditions like thyroid issues, sleep apnea, or nutrient deficiencies.

Can exercise help prevent energy drops?
Regular exercise improves overall energy stability, but timing matters. Intense workouts too close to bedtime can disrupt sleep and worsen next-day energy crashes.
